Fishing Experience: Los Sueños vs. Quepos
Los Sueños: The Sport fishing Capital
Los Sueños, located on Costa Rica’s Pacific coast, is often considered the ultimate sportfishing destination. The Los Sueños Marina is a top-tier facility with luxury amenities, making it a favorite among serious anglers and high-end travelers.
Targeted Fish Species: Expect to catch marlin (blue, black, and striped), sailfish, yellowfin tuna, dorado (mahi-mahi), roosterfish, and snapper.
Fishing Seasons: Peak sailfish season runs from December to April, while marlin is most abundant from September to November.
Los Sueños fishing charters are known for high success rates, with experienced crews and well-maintained boats ensuring an exciting and productive trip.

Quepos: The Gateway to Offshore Fishing
Quepos, just south of Los Sueños, is another top fishing destination, best known as the home of the annual Offshore World Championship. The Marina Pez Vela serves as the hub for fishing charters in Quepos.
Targeted Fish Species: Like Los Sueños, Quepos offers sailfish, marlin, tuna, dorado, and inshore species like roosterfish and snook.
Fishing Seasons: The best time for sailfish is January to April, while marlin is common in late summer and fall.
While Quepos fishing charters are excellent, Los Sueños generally has more consistent fishing conditions year-round due to its proximity to deep-sea waters.
Marina & Charter Quality
Los Sueños Marina
Los Sueños Marina is considered the best marina in Central America, offering:A wide selection of luxury fishing charters High-end restaurants and bars Top-tier fishing gear and experienced crewsEasy access to deep-sea fishing within 10-20 miles.
Marina Pez Vela (Quepos)
Marina Pez Vela is a newer, high-quality marina with:A variety of affordable and luxury fishing chartersA scenic location near Manuel Antonio National Park Less crowded waters compared to Los Sueños
While both marinas offer great experiences, Los Sueños is preferred for premium, all-inclusive fishing charters, while Quepos is a great alternative for those looking for a more budget-friendly trip.
Accommodation & Travel Experience
Los Sueños: Luxury and Comfort
Los Sueños is known for its upscale resorts, private villas, and golf courses. Many fishing enthusiasts stay at the Los Sueños Resort & Marina, which provides a five-star experience.
Quepos: Laid-Back and Adventurous
Quepos offers a more affordable and authentic Costa Rican experience. It’s a short drive from Manuel Antonio National Park, making it perfect for travelers who want to mix fishing with wildlife exploration.
